Start by rinsing your quinoa thoroughly under cold water using a fine mesh strainer. This step ensures the removal of any bitter outer coating.
In a medium-sized pot, combine the quinoa and 2 cups of water.
Bring this mixture to a boil, then reduce the heat to low, cover, and let it simmer for about 15 minutes or until the quinoa becomes translucent and the water is absorbed.
Once done, remove the pot from heat, and let it sit for 5 minutes. Then, fluff it up using a fork.
In a separate mixing bowl, combine the finely chopped cilantro, lime zest, lime juice, and olive oil. Mix until well integrated. This cilantro-lime dressing is the essence of your Cilantro Lime Quinoa Bowl.
To the quinoa, add the diced red bell pepper, black beans, sweet corn kernels, cherry tomatoes, and sliced avocado.
Drizzle the cilantro-lime dressing over this quinoa mix, ensuring every ingredient gets a hint of the zesty punch.
Season your Cilantro Lime Quinoa Bowl mixture with salt and pepper to your liking, and give it a gentle toss.
